How to round to nearest integer c++

Web30 sep. 2024 · The element, providing minimum difference will be the nearest to the specified value. Use numpy.argmin(), to obtain the index of the smallest element in difference_array[]. In the case of multiple minimum values, the first occurrence will be returned. Print the nearest element, and its index from the given array. Example 1: WebThe round () function in C++ returns the integral value that is nearest to the argument, with halfway cases rounded away from zero. It is defined in the cmath header file. Example …

Round up to nearest power of 2 in C++ - CodeSpeedy

Web12 mrt. 2024 · Solution 1: We first add 7 and get a number x + 7, then we use the technique to find next smaller multiple of 8 for (x+7). For example, if x = 12, we add 7 to get 19. Now we find next smaller multiple of 19, which is 16. Solution 2: An efficient approach to solve this problem using bitwise AND operation is: x = (x + 7) & (-8) Web16 jan. 2013 · It accepts an integer greater than 0 as an argument; It rounds that integer up to the nearest value so that only the first digit is not a zero; For example: 53 comes out … floating full bed plans https://prioryphotographyni.com

Rounding integers to nearest ten or hundred in C

Web20 jun. 2012 · The round functions round their argument to the nearest integer value in floating-point format, rounding halfway cases away from zero, regardless of the current … Web28 mrt. 2024 · I'm doing an area of a cylinder calculator and for some reason, c++ is rounding to the nearest number , here's my code: int volume () { int radius; int height; … Web17 okt. 2024 · Using round () method The ‘cmath’ library has one round () method to convert a number to its nearest integer. So this is converting the floating point number up to 0 decimal places. The syntax is like below. Syntax Using round () method include float res = round ( ); great house melbourne cup 2021

Floor Division in Python

Category:How to round off numbers nearest 10 in C++ - CodeSpeedy

Tags:How to round to nearest integer c++

How to round to nearest integer c++

How to Round Down a Number to a Nearest Integer in C#

Web14 mrt. 2012 · 3. Adding +0.5 to a negative input before turning it into an int will give the wrong answer. The correct quick-and-dirty way is to test the input sign for <0, and then … Web11 apr. 2024 · Use Math.Floor () Method to Round Down a Number to a Nearest Integer. The Math.Floor () method returns the largest integral value, less or equal to the …

How to round to nearest integer c++

Did you know?

Web8 okt. 2024 ·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 Programming - Beginner to Advanced;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with … Web12 mei 2014 · round() has non-standard rounding semantics: halfway cases round away from zero. The best choice is usually nearbyint() (or nearbyintf/l), because it can be …

Web13 apr. 2024 · C++ vector容器详解目录vector容器的基本概念1.vector的构造函数2.vector的赋值操作3.vector的容量与大小4.vector的插入和删除5.vector数据存取6.vector互换容器7.vector预留空间写在最后 目录 vector容器的基本概念 功能:vector容器的功能和数组非常相似,使用时可以把它看成一个数组 vector和普通数组的区别: 1 ... Web8 jun. 2024 ·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self-Paced Courses; Programming Languages. C++ Programming - Beginner to Advanced; Java Programming - Beginner to Advanced; C Programming - Beginner to Advanced; Web Development. Full Stack Development with …

Web22 feb. 2024 · The Int and Trunc functions round a number to an integer (whole number without a decimal): Int rounds down to the nearest integer. Trunc truncates the number to just the integer portion by removing any decimal portion. The difference between Int and Trunc is in the handling of negative numbers. WebThe ROUND function rounds a number to a specified number of digits. For example, if cell A1 contains 23.7825, and you want to round that value to two decimal places, you can use the following formula: =ROUND(A1, 2) The result of this function is 23.78. Syntax. ROUND(number, num_digits) The ROUND function syntax has the following arguments:

Web1. Using std::round Starting with C++11, the std::round function is the most elegant way to round a floating-point value to the nearest int. If your compiler supports it, you can use it as follows: 1 2 3 4 5 6 7 8 9 10 11 #include #include int main() { std::cout << std::round(3.49) << std::endl; // 3

WebHi everyone. I'm just learning C++. I know that you can write code that will convert a decimal number into an integer, by just dropping the number after the decimal. But how would you write it if you want it to actually round the decimal off to the nearest integer... i.e.- instead of turning 7.9 into 7..... so that 7.9 turns into 8??? floating furniture ff14Web10 apr. 2024 · The above code shows the result of the integer division and floor division when 5 is divided by 2. In Python 3.x, the result of the division operation is always a float, even if the operands are integers. Therefore, when we use floor division on two integers, we get an integer result rounded down to the nearest integer. greathouse mortgageWeb29 apr. 2024 · Rounding a float is not that simple. Floats are by design not 100% accurate so if you want a 100% accurate number you will need to use integers. Floats are used because they can display very large numbers without requiring a … greathouse menuWeb5 dec. 2010 · 3 Answers. Sorted by: 40. Add half of the multiple, then round down. result = ( (number + multiple/2) / multiple) * multiple; or. result = number + multiple/2; result -= … greathouse medical transportation llcWeb13 mrt. 2024 · Whoever downvoted @VRonin's answer, please don't (unless it was a mis-click!), as his answer was correct.. @diverger Both std::round() and qRound() round to an integer. However, they may not necessarily round to the same integer in the case of X.5 because there is no "correct"/"unambiguous" answer in that case. The implementation … great house melbourne cupWeb20 feb. 2024 · Let's round down the given number n to the nearest integer which ends with 0 and store this value in a variable a. a = (n / 10) * 10. So, the round up n (call it b) is b = a + 10. If n - a > b - n then the answer is b otherwise the answer is a. Below is the implementation of the above approach: C++ Java Python3 C# PHP Javascript Output 4720 floating full length mirrorWebRound down value Rounds x downward, returning the largest integral value that is not greater than x. C99 C++11 Header provides a type-generic macro version of this function. Parameters x Value to round down. Return Value The value of x rounded downward (as a floating-point value). Example 1 2 3 4 5 6 7 8 9 10 11 12 floating furniture bedroom